    Harriet Maxine Hageman (born October 18, 1962) is an American politician and attorney serving as the U.S. representative for Wyoming's at-large congressional district since 2023. She is a member of the Republican Party. A Wyoming native, Hageman holds degrees from the University of Wyoming and has spent her career as a trial attorney.
